About the New Braunfels Subdrop Scene

Subdrop refers to the emotional and physical low that can follow an intense BDSM scene or extended power exchange dynamic, particularly for submissives or bottoms. Often described as a crash after the neurochemical high of subspace—that altered, focused mental state achieved during intense submission—Subdrop involves feelings of emptiness, melancholy, fatigue, or emotional vulnerability lasting hours to days post-scene. The term distinguishes itself from related phenomena like topspace (the dominant's corresponding euphoric state) or the general fatigue anyone might experience after physical exertion; Subdrop is specifically tied to the psychological release and vulnerability inherent in consensual power exchange. It occurs because intense scenes trigger the release of endorphins, adrenaline, and other neurochemicals that create a natural high, followed by a corresponding dip when those levels normalize. Understanding Subdrop is fundamental to informed consent in BDSM, as experienced practitioners recognize it not as a flaw in play but as a predictable physiological response requiring intentional aftercare—physical comfort, reassurance, hydration, and emotional check-ins—to navigate safely and responsibly.

In practice, negotiating Subdrop begins during scene planning: experienced partners discuss whether a particular dynamic or intensity level is likely to trigger it and agree on aftercare protocols beforehand. Some submissives find that structured aftercare—cuddling, gentle touch, reassurance about their worth and the top's continued care—prevents or minimizes Subdrop severity, while others benefit from time alone to process or from follow-up conversations hours or days later. The question of whether Subdrop is inherently dangerous has a straightforward answer: no, if properly managed. The real risk lies in ignoring it—in tops who disappear after scenes without checking in, or in submissives who don't communicate their needs because they believe they should simply "tough it out." What Subdrop actually feels like varies widely; some describe it as sadness without cause, others as exhaustion or a sense of purposelessness. Negotiating your personal Subdrop triggers and recovery style is as important as discussing hard limits or safewords, and many practitioners find that Subdrop decreases in intensity over time as partners learn each other's patterns and as submissives develop stronger grounding techniques between scenes.

New Braunfels sits in a unique cultural position along the Guadalupe River corridor in south-central Texas, where conservative family-oriented values historically dominant in the Hill Country region meet the growing progressive demographics of people relocating from Austin and San Antonio. The local kink interest in Subdrop and broader BDSM practices reflects this tension: there are active practitioners throughout the city's established residential areas like Creekside and the North Loop districts, as well as among the younger professional population near the riverside commercial zones, yet the scene remains relatively quiet and private compared to larger urban centers. Most New Braunfels kinksters who seek in-person munches, workshops, or more extensive BDSM events make the forty-five-minute drive north to Austin, where regular educational meetups and larger play spaces accommodate the kind of scene exploration and Subdrop discussion groups that aren't yet established locally. For those preferring to stay closer, informal check-ins and discussion circles happen through private networks and online platforms, with many local submissives using World of Kink and similar spaces to process Subdrop experiences without the anonymity concerns of smaller-town socializing. The cultural character of New Braunfels—family-centered, outdoor-recreation-focused, with roots in both agricultural and small-business traditions—means that kinksters here tend to be pragmatic about their practice, prioritizing safety and communication over public visibility, and often building scenes and relationships within existing trusted circles rather than through large organizational structures.
